Course Details

Global Food Security: An overview of global food security, including the definition, causes, and consequences of food insecurity. This unit will also cover the current state of global food security and the efforts being made to improve it.
Agricultural Practices: This unit will explore sustainable agricultural practices that can help improve food security in developing countries. Topics may include conservation agriculture, agroforestry, and sustainable irrigation systems.
Food Policy: An examination of food policies and their impact on food security. This unit will cover policies related to agriculture, trade, and social protection, as well as the role of governments and international organizations in promoting food security.
Supply Chain Management: This unit will explore the role of supply chain management in ensuring food security. Topics may include storage and transportation infrastructure, food safety standards, and traceability systems.
Economic Development: An overview of economic development and its relationship to food security. This unit will cover topics such as economic growth, poverty reduction, and income inequality, and how these factors impact food security.
Climate Change and Food Security: This unit will examine the impact of climate change on food security. Topics may include the effects of extreme weather events, changing precipitation patterns, and rising temperatures on agricultural productivity and food availability.
Food Loss and Waste: An exploration of food loss and waste, including the causes and consequences of food waste, and strategies for reducing food loss and waste throughout the supply chain.
Nutrition and Food Security: This unit will examine the relationship between nutrition and food security. Topics may include the importance of nutrition for health and development, the causes and consequences of malnutrition, and strategies for improving nutrition in developing countries.
